Abstract: This design is the business-living building, located in Zhejiang. The business construction area of about 4544.7㎡, the living construction area of about 4055.7㎡and bottom covers about 785㎡, the total high is 19.6 m, is a multi-storey building. The earthquake intensity is six degrees to setup defences, the forth grade antidetonation, Structural safety grade two and the design life span of 50 years. The Design did not consider seismic calculations. The program used cast-in-place reinforced concrete frame structure, the main load-bearing structure of the two-way framework. Conducting load calculation and after estimating beam, select a framework for load calculations, using layered calculated forces, later analysis the most unfavorable load portfolio ,through D value derived wind load, and then cross-section beams framework for the design. And select some floor panels, staircases, the independent foundation and footing beam design.
